摘 要:结合电子测量技术和计算机智能控制技术,设计了一种新型高性能智能化的离子色谱电导检测系统。系统采用两级分布式控制方式,在有效抑制噪声的同时,能够精确并且智能化的完成离子色谱信号的放大、采集、处理、谱图显示等功能。文章介绍了该系统的硬件组成、软件设计以及系统工作的基本原理,并给出测量实例。实验结果表明系统运行良好,结果可靠,完全可应用于实际的离子色谱检测。Combined with the technology of electronics measurement and computer intelligent control, a novel conductivity detector for ion chromatography with high performance and intelligence is presented in this article. The system implements a two-level distributed control, so it can not only suppress the noise effectively, but also accomplish such functions as magnifying, gathering and processing the ion chromatography signal precisely and intelligently, as well as displaying the spectrum of the ion chromatography signal. This article introduces the hardware construction and software design of the system and the principle of the system working. A measurement instance is also presented in this paper. The experimental result shows that the system runs well and the datum are reliable, so it can be applied in practical detection for ion chromatography completely.
